Mobile Resident Evil 4 -The Legendary Classic
Deal Price: 9,99 (Retail Price: 19,99)
At the top of the list is Resident Evil 4, which can be considered one of the most important games in the contemporary horror. First launched in 2005, RE4 broke down the third-person shooter with over-the-shoulder camera and tactical battle mechanics. The mobile adaptation relies upon a lot of what made the original a classic, such as a tight gameplay, a tough boss and memorable storyline featuring Leon S. Kennedy.
The iOS 15 and up version of the app is now up to snuff and introduces high-res textures, the ability to remap game controllers, and the option of using an external gamepad. In case you have not tried the village, the chainsaw-armed enemies, or the creepy atmosphere, then this discounted version is the perfect point of entry.
AAA Horror Resident Evil Village iPhone 15 Pro Users
Original price: Approximately 29.99 (Price reduced to 15.99)
The other gem to this sale of Resident Evil apps is the mobile version of Capcom latest game in the series, Resident Evil Village. Exclusively on high-end consoles and PCs up until now, this title is now available on iPhone 15 Pro and M1 chip-enabled iPads or new generation.
Taking place in a gothic village in Europe, the eighth major installment sees Ethan Winters digging up the secrets of the haunted village and fighting the now-meme Lady Dimitrescu. Beautiful to look at and full of narrative, the iOS port is in high frame rate, graphics options and cloud saves using Apple Game Center.
Even though this version demands a powerful device, this steep decline of its price (45 percent) makes it unavoidable by ardent lovers of horror games wherever they may roam.
Resident Evil 7: Biohazard A first-person fright fest
Price: It was originally priced at a set price of 24.99 and now selling at a lower price of 14.99.
The third hot deal on the list of the Resident Evil app sale is Resident Evil 7: Biohazard which became the departure point into the new and crazy direction of the franchise. With its change of style to first-person view and orientation to more psychological horror, Capcom redefined the horror that it was renowned to. The result? It is both a terrifying and addictive experience that brought the survival horror back to the new generation of gamers.
This game runs sufficiently great on iOS on the highest Apple phones and tablets, and sustains smooth drawings and guide responses. The surround sound and the level architecture that causes claustrophobia make this an ideal game to play on a pair of headphones in a darkened room, should you be brave enough.
Resident Evil 2 Remake The Fan Favorite Returns
Deal Price is 19.99 (previously 39.99)
A remake that has become one of the most famed in recent modern history of gaming, the iOS rendition of the Resident Evil 2 Remake can now be found in this exciting Capcom sale. This game was initially released on consoles in 2019; it involves Leon and Claire returning to the zombie-ridden streets of Raccoon city in a highly detailed fashion.
The game has better lighting and realistic settings, a newer voice acting, and it does not leave behind the original game in 1998. The iOS version has such features as adaptive controls and variable resolution setting so that game users can adjust visuals versus performance.
Although it is the costliest among the four, the discount nearly half of its value is a good investment any mobile gamer can make to get console quality horror in his or her pocket.

Tricks Before Downloading
Before you can go into the action, remember the following:
Device Features: Other games, such as Resident Evil Village and Resident Evil 7, need more recent iPhones (iPhone 15 Pro and up) or iPad with M1 and above chips.
Storage Requirements: These games are huge and they might be more than 10GB. You will need sufficient space of storage.
Gamepads Enhance Play: Although the touchscreen controls are great, a Bluetooth game controller adds to the level of playability to a greatly improved degree.
Wi-Fi Recommended: With the large files, a reliable Wi-Fi connection is strongly advised in the process of downloading and installing.
